How Our Floodwater Removal Process Works

When you call us for Floodwater Removal, our team springs into action. We understand the critical importance of responding quickly to reduce damage and prevent further problems. Our process is designed to be efficient and effective, ensuring that your property is restored to its original condition as soon as possible.

Step 1: Initial Assessment

We’ll send a team to your property to assess the damage and identify the source of the floodwater.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to measure the water level, identify any potential hazards, and develop a plan to remove the water and restore your property.

Step 2: Water Removal

Using advanced equipment, including submersible pumps and wet/dry vacuums, our team will quickly and efficiently remove the standing water from your property. We’ll work to remove as much water as possible to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old and mildew growth.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water has been removed, our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property. This step is critical in preventing further damage and ensuring that your property is restored to its original condition.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Our team will thoroughly clean and sanitize your property to remove any remaining dirt, debris, and bacteria. This step is essential in preventing the growth of mold and mildew and ensuring that your property is safe and healthy to occupy.

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ction

Finally, our team will work with you to restore and reconstruct your property to its original condition. This may involve replacing damaged materials, repairing structural damage, and completing any necessary repairs.

Warning Signs You Need Floodwater Removal

Don’t ignore these warning signs, they can show a larger problem that needs immediate attention: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, persistent musty odors can be a sign of mold and mildew growth. If you notice these odors,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age. If you notice this issue, it’s crucial to address it qu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.

Discolored or Peeling Paint

Discolored or peeling paint can be a sign of water damage or exposure to moisture. If you notice this issue, it’s essential to address it qu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.

Water Stains or Leaks

Water stains or leaks can be a sign of a larger issue that needs immediate attention. If you notice these signs, don’t hesitate to call us for Floodwater Removal service.

Unusual Sounds or Creaks

Unusual sounds or creaks can be a sign of structural damage or water damage. If you notice these signs,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.

Visible Water Damage

Visible water damage, including standing water or water stains, is a clear indication that you need Floodwater Removal service. Don’t wait, call us today to schedule your service.

Floodwater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Standing water in a small area (less than 100 sq. Ft.) Yes No You can likely handle this situation with a wet/dry vacuum and some elbow grease.
Standing water in a large area (over 100 sq. Ft.) No Yes This situation need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ively.
Water damage to structural elements (e.g., walls, floors, ceilings) No Yes This situation needs specialized expertise to assess and repair safely and effectively.
Water damage to sensitive materials (e.g., electronics, artwork) No Yes This situation needs specialized expertise to handle and restore safely and effectively.
Visible mold or mildew growth No Yes This situation needs specialized expertise to assess and remediate safely and effectively.
Water damage in a crawl space or attic No Yes This situation needs specialized expertise to assess and repair safely and effectively.

Floodwater Removal Cost in Plantation, FL

The cost of Floodwater Removal in Plantation, FL,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on the extent of the damage and the equipment and expertise required to complete the job.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Inspection $200 – $1,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and complexity of the job
Water Removal and Drying $1,000 – $5,000 Amount of water, size of affected area, and equipment required
Dehumidification and Drying $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, complexity of the job, and equipment required
Cleaning and Sanitizing $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, complexity of the job, and equipment required
Restoration and Reconstruction $2,000 – $10,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and complexity of the job
Disinfection and Odor Removal $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, complexity of the job, and equipment required

Is Floodwater Removal a Health Risk?

Yes, standing water can be a health risk due to the presence of bacteria, viruses, and other microorganisms. Our team will take all necessary precautions to ensure that your property is safe and healthy to occupy.

Can I Prevent Floodwater Damage?

Yes, there are steps you can take to prevent floodwater damage. These include installing a sump pump, checking your gutters and downspouts regularly, and ensuring that your property is properly graded to prevent water accumulation.
